Effects of Cash and Counseling on personal care and well-being.

Abstract

OBJECTIVE

To examine how a new model of consumer-directed care changes the way that consumers with disabilities meet their personal care needs and, in turn, affects their well-being.

STUDY SETTING

Eligible Medicaid beneficiaries in Arkansas, Florida, and New Jersey volunteered to participate in the demonstration and were randomly assigned to receive an allowance and direct their own Medicaid supportive services as Cash and Counseling consumers (the treatment group) or to rely on Medicaid services as usual (the control group). The demonstration included elderly and non-elderly adults in all three states and children in Florida.

DATA SOURCES

Telephone interviews administered 9 months after random assignment.

METHODS

Outcomes for the treatment and control group were compared, using regression analysis to control for consumers' baseline characteristics.

PRINCIPAL FINDINGS

Treatment group members were more likely to receive paid care, had greater satisfaction with their care, and had fewer unmet needs than control group members in nearly every state and age group. However, among the elderly in Florida, Cash and Counseling had little effect on these outcomes because so few treatment group members actually received the allowance. Within each state and age group, consumers were not more susceptible to adverse health outcomes or injuries under Cash and Counseling.

CONCLUSIONS

Cash and Counseling substantially improves the lives of Medicaid beneficiaries of all ages if consumers actually receive the allowance that the program offers.

摘要

目的

研究一种新型的消费者导向型照护模式如何改变残疾消费者满足其个人照护需求的方式,进而影响他们的福祉。

研究背景

阿肯色州、佛罗里达州和新泽西州符合条件的医疗补助受益人自愿参与该示范项目,并被随机分配,作为“现金与咨询”项目的消费者接受津贴并自行指导其医疗补助支持服务(治疗组),或像往常一样依赖医疗补助服务(对照组)。该示范项目涵盖了三个州的老年人和非老年人以及佛罗里达州的儿童。

数据来源

随机分配9个月后进行的电话访谈。

方法

比较治疗组和对照组的结果,使用回归分析来控制消费者的基线特征。

主要发现

在几乎每个州和年龄组中,治疗组成员比对照组成员更有可能获得付费照护,对其照护的满意度更高,未满足的需求也更少。然而,在佛罗里达州的老年人中,“现金与咨询”项目对这些结果几乎没有影响,因为实际获得津贴的治疗组成员很少。在每个州和年龄组内,消费者在“现金与咨询”项目下并不更容易出现不良健康结果或受伤。

结论

如果消费者实际获得该项目提供的津贴,“现金与咨询”项目能显著改善所有年龄段医疗补助受益人的生活。
